I'm Sehresh Honey, a mom of two lovely daughters living in Gulshan Iqbal Colony, Gojra. We were going through a tough financial time, but my life took a turn when I joined Society for Human Development's sewing center in 2025. I learned so much - sewing kids' clothes, designing shalwar kameez, and even basic machine repair . Embroidery, stitching, and fabric design skills came along too. Now, I'm stitching quality clothes for others and contributing in our household income from my home. My husband and I are super excited to work together for our kids' future. The sewing center gave me skills, hope, and confidence . I'm feeling empowered, getting recognized in my community, and showing my daughters what's possible . Looking forward to earning steady, gaining respect, and building a brighter future for my family. Thank you.
